These Awesome Mums Prove You’re Never Too Old To Start Skateboarding

They are all over fifty - and they rip harder than you...

 

Age is just a number. No one proves that more so than these four radical women.

They are all mums over the age of 50 who only took up skateboarding a few years ago.

Barbara Odanaka, a journalist and author, took up skating when she was 10 years old but hadn’t touched her board in years – until after she became a mum.

It wasn’t until a therapist said to her, “Think about something you used to do before you became a mum, something that gave you great joy. You need to do it every day for ten minutes.”

“It took me less than a second. I just said ‘skateboarding’,” she says.
